The Professional Certificate in Green Energy Policy: High-Performance program prepares learners for a variety of green energy roles in the UK job market. This 3D pie chart displays some of the most relevant job roles and their respective representation in the industry. 1. **Solar Energy Engineer**: With the increasing adoption of solar energy technology, the demand for skilled professionals in this role has grown significantly. Anticipated salary range in the UK is £25,000 - £45,000. 2. **Wind Turbine Technician**: As offshore wind farms become more prevalent, there is a growing need for skilled technicians to install, maintain, and repair wind turbines. The typical salary range in the UK is between £25,000 - £40,000. 3. **Energy Auditor**: Energy auditors evaluate the energy efficiency of residential and commercial buildings and provide recommendations to reduce energy consumption. The UK salary range for energy auditors is approximately £20,000 - £40,000. 4. **Green Building Consultant**: Green building consultants focus on ensuring buildings are designed and constructed with sustainability in mind. The UK salary range for green building consultants is £25,000 - £50,000. 5. **Policy Analyst (Green Energy)**: Policy analysts in green energy assess the impact of existing and proposed policies on the green energy sector. In the UK, policy analysts can expect a salary range of £25,000 - £50,000. 6. **Sustainability Consultant**: Sustainability consultants work with businesses and organizations to develop sustainable strategies and practices. The UK salary range for this role is typically between £25,000 - £60,000. 7. **Energy Storage Specialist**: With the increasing use of renewable energy, energy storage specialists play a crucial role in managing and storing excess power for later use. The UK salary range for energy storage specialists is £30,000 - £60,000. In summary, this 3D pie chart provides a visual representation of various green energy roles and their respective significance in the UK job market.
